Eubank‍ Jr. Hospitalized ‍After Grueling Victory, father Reflects on Health⁣ Scare

Following‌ a hard-fought ‍points victory, Chris Eubank Jr. was hospitalized as a standard precautionary measure for boxers after a‌ demanding fight. His father, Chris‍ Eubank Sr., revealed the severity of ⁤his son’s condition post-fight, highlighting concerns ⁢stemming from severe dehydration and the brutal nature‌ of the bout.

Weight Cut ‍Struggles and ‌Rehydration Limits Addressed

Eubank Jr. faced notable challenges in making the middleweight limit of 160 pounds (11st 6lb). He ‍was even fined £375,000 for exceeding the ‌weight by a mere 0.05lb the day before ⁤the fight. Furthermore, a rehydration clause restricted him to gaining no more than​ 10lb‍ by ‍the morning of the match,‍ adding to the physical strain.

Eubank Sr. Details⁢ Post-Fight Fears, Recalls Watson Fight

Eubank⁣ Sr. recounted the ​emotional impact of seeing his son in distress, drawing parallels ​to his 1991 fight⁤ with Michael Watson, where Watson suffered lasting brain damage. He described his son’s face as “blown up” and revealed the significant⁣ dehydration Eubank Jr. experienced, contributing to his discomfort in the hospital for over 24 hours. “People don’t know but ⁣my son was touch-and-go and the only way we are going to‍ know if he is ⁢going to be OK is with the CT scan,” he stated.

Emotional toll ‍and Father’s Pride

Reflecting on the fight, Eubank Sr. expressed immense‍ pride in his son’s ‍performance and also in Conor ‍Benn.. Despite the⁢ victory, he voiced a strong reluctance ​to see his son endure such a physically taxing experience again, adding: “[But] I ‍don’t ‍want​ my son to go through that again. He doesn’t know his life was in the balance and neither does he care.”
